The Strategic Imperative for Reseller Enablement in ERP
As enterprises increasingly adopt SaaS-based ecommerce platforms, the role of the ERP partner shifts from pure implementation to operational enablement. Reseller enablement systems are not merely sales channels; they are complex operational extensions of the core ERP environment. For ERP partners, MSPs, and system integrators, the challenge lies in scaling these reseller operations without compromising the integrity, accuracy, and governance of the underlying ERP system. This requires a deliberate architectural and governance approach that treats reseller enablement as a first-class operational domain, rather than an afterthought to the core implementation.
The primary business problem is operational scalability. As the number of resellers and their respective customer bases grows, the volume of transactions, data points, and support interactions increases exponentially. Without a structured enablement system, partners face risks of data inconsistency, financial reconciliation errors, and service level degradation. The solution involves defining clear roles, responsibilities, and technical integration patterns that allow the ERP to handle the increased load while maintaining strict governance over data flow and financial accuracy.
Defining the Partner Governance Model
Effective reseller enablement begins with a robust governance model that clearly delineates ownership between the ERP vendor, the implementation partner, and the reseller. In a typical white-label or partner-led model, the ERP vendor provides the core platform and API infrastructure. The implementation partner is responsible for configuring the enablement system, managing the integration layer, and providing ongoing managed services. The reseller, in turn, is responsible for customer acquisition, first-line support, and local market compliance.
This matrix ensures that no single entity is overwhelmed by operational demands. The implementation partner acts as the central hub, managing the technical complexity of the integration while the reseller focuses on customer-facing activities. This separation of duties is critical for maintaining operational stability as the ecosystem scales.
Architectural Considerations for Scalability
The technical architecture of a reseller enablement system must be designed for high availability and low latency. Ecommerce transactions are real-time, and any delay in synchronizing order data with the ERP can lead to inventory inaccuracies and customer dissatisfaction. Therefore, the integration layer should utilize asynchronous processing patterns where possible, leveraging message queues or event-driven architectures to decouple the ecommerce platform from the ERP core.
Middleware plays a crucial role in this architecture. It acts as a buffer between the SaaS ecommerce platform and the ERP, handling data transformation, validation, and error management. This layer should be built with observability in mind, providing detailed logging and monitoring capabilities that allow the implementation partner to quickly identify and resolve issues. Additionally, the architecture must support multi-tenancy, allowing the ERP to handle data from multiple resellers and their customers without cross-contamination or performance degradation.
Integration Patterns and Data Synchronization
Data synchronization between the ecommerce platform and the ERP is the backbone of the reseller enablement system. Key data entities include products, inventory, orders, customers, and financial transactions. Each of these entities requires specific synchronization strategies to ensure data consistency. For example, inventory levels should be updated in near real-time to prevent overselling, while financial transactions may be batched for processing to reduce load on the ERP.
REST APIs are the standard for communication between these systems, but the implementation partner must define clear API contracts and versioning strategies. This ensures that changes to the ecommerce platform or the ERP do not break the integration. Additionally, the system should include robust error handling and retry mechanisms to manage transient failures. Data validation rules should be enforced at the middleware layer to prevent invalid data from entering the ERP, which could lead to downstream financial and operational issues.
Financial Reconciliation and Revenue Recognition
One of the most complex aspects of reseller enablement is financial reconciliation. In a reseller model, the ERP must accurately track revenue, costs, and margins for each reseller and their customers. This requires a detailed understanding of the commercial terms between the partner and the reseller, including commission structures, discount tiers, and payment terms. The implementation partner must configure the ERP to automatically calculate and allocate these financial elements based on the defined rules.
Automated reconciliation processes are essential to reduce manual effort and minimize errors. The system should generate daily or weekly reconciliation reports that compare the ecommerce platform's transaction data with the ERP's financial records. Any discrepancies should be flagged for review by the implementation partner or the reseller, depending on the nature of the issue. This process ensures that financial statements are accurate and that revenue recognition complies with applicable accounting standards.
Operational Risk Management and Security
Scaling reseller operations introduces new operational risks, including data breaches, service outages, and compliance violations. The implementation partner must implement a comprehensive risk management framework that identifies, assesses, and mitigates these risks. This includes regular security audits, penetration testing, and vulnerability assessments of the integration layer and the ERP environment.
Security controls must be applied at every layer of the architecture. Identity and access management (IAM) should be used to ensure that only authorized users and systems can access sensitive data. Least privilege principles should be enforced, granting users and services only the permissions they need to perform their functions. Additionally, data encryption should be used for data in transit and at rest, and audit trails should be maintained to track all access and modifications to sensitive data.
Partner Onboarding and Training
A successful reseller enablement system depends on the ability of resellers to effectively use the platform and support their customers. The implementation partner must develop a comprehensive onboarding and training program that covers technical setup, operational processes, and support procedures. This program should be tailored to the specific needs of each reseller, taking into account their size, industry, and technical capabilities.
Training should be ongoing, with regular updates to reflect changes in the platform, integration, or operational processes. The implementation partner should provide a partner portal that serves as a central hub for documentation, training materials, and support resources. This portal should also include self-service tools that allow resellers to manage their own configurations, monitor their performance, and access support tickets.
Monitoring, Observability, and Continuous Improvement
To ensure operational scalability, the implementation partner must implement a robust monitoring and observability framework. This framework should provide real-time visibility into the health of the integration layer, the ERP, and the ecommerce platform. Key performance indicators (KPIs) should be defined and tracked, including transaction volume, latency, error rates, and data consistency metrics.
Alerting mechanisms should be configured to notify the implementation partner and the reseller of any anomalies or failures. This allows for proactive issue resolution, minimizing the impact on customers and operations. Additionally, the implementation partner should regularly review monitoring data to identify trends and areas for improvement. This continuous improvement process is essential for maintaining the scalability and reliability of the reseller enablement system.
Commercial Considerations and Partner Ecosystems
The commercial model for reseller enablement must be aligned with the operational capabilities of the system. The implementation partner should work with the ERP vendor and the resellers to define a fair and transparent commercial structure that reflects the value provided by each party. This includes defining the pricing model for the enablement system, the revenue share between the partner and the reseller, and the terms for support and maintenance.
As the partner ecosystem grows, the implementation partner must manage the complexity of multiple resellers with different needs and expectations. This requires a scalable operating model that can accommodate new resellers without significant rework. The implementation partner should leverage automation and standardization to reduce the time and cost of onboarding new resellers, while maintaining the quality and consistency of the service.
